Storage365 AB

Storage365 is a digital marketplace for storage areas, were both real estate companies as well as private people can efficiently rent out their empty spaces and hence increase their space utilization. This is achieved by creating ads for their spaces to this marketplace and features like calendar booking, payment engine, legal contracts, digital signing as well as financial reporting and customer support is included. This allows for companies or privates with need for storage to make simple and secure bookings for things like furniture, RVs, caravans, boats, construction materials etc. The company was founded in Sweden in november 2016, the BETA was released to the market in Oct 2017 and the commercial release in Oct 2018. Now some thousands of transactions are created and Storage365 will be targeting releases to the Nordics by the end of 2020.

Blue Lice

The agonizing 15 bilion problem of sealice infection have troubled the aquaculture industry for decades. We want to provide a solution to tackle the sea lice problem from its very beginning.Blue Lice wants to switch focus from treatment to prevention!By catching sealice before the fish gets infected we reduce selice before it becomes a problem. Our product will make healthier more sustainable seafarming.Blue Lice have found a way to attract, capture and contain sealice before infecting the fish.

Tendo - For people, not symptoms

Grasp life with the support of Tendo – a soft exoskeleton, a robotic glove, which assist a person to grip, hold and release objects. It’s created for people who struggles with daily activities due to e.g.a a stroke or spinal cord injury. By combining the users voice with revolutionary robotics, Tendo helps people to regain their independence while addressing a global healthcare challenge by reducing the strain on the care sector and enabling users to contribute to society once again.
